What is a silicon validation engineer?

Silicon Validation Engineers are professionals responsible for testing and validating integrated circuits (ICs) or chips after they are manufactured. They verify that the hardware functions correctly according to design specifications by running a series of tests and debugging any identified issues. Their role ensures that the silicon meets performance, reliability, and functionality requirements before it goes into mass production. This position often requires strong skills in hardware debugging, test development, and collaboration with design and verification teams.

What are some common challenges faced by silicon validation engineers during the pre-silicon and post-silicon validation phases?

Silicon Validation Engineers often encounter challenges such as identifying and debugging complex hardware bugs, working with incomplete or evolving specifications, and managing tight project schedules. During pre-silicon validation, simulating real-world scenarios and ensuring test coverage can be difficult due to limitations in simulation speed and model accuracy. In post-silicon validation, engineers must efficiently reproduce and isolate issues using lab equipment, which requires strong problem-solving skills and close collaboration with design, firmware, and test teams to resolve defects quickly.

What are the key skills and qualifications needed to thrive as a silicon validation engineer, and why are they important?

To thrive as a Silicon Validation Engineer, you need a solid background in electrical engineering, digital/analog circuit design, and experience with test methodologies, often supported by a relevant bachelor's or master's degree. Familiarity with lab equipment (oscilloscopes, logic analyzers), scripting languages (such as Python or Perl), and validation tools (like UVM or SystemVerilog) is typically required. Strong problem-solving skills, attention to detail, and effective communication are valuable soft skills for this role. These competencies are essential for ensuring silicon products meet design specifications, function reliably, and are delivered on schedule.

What is the difference between Silicon Validation Engineer vs Digital Design Engineer?

AspectSilicon Validation EngineerDigital Design Engineer
Primary FocusVerifying silicon chips post-fabrication to ensure functionality and performanceDesigning and developing digital integrated circuits and systems
Work EnvironmentLaboratories, testing facilities, and cleanroomsDesign offices, CAD tools, and simulation environments
Required SkillsHardware testing, debugging, scripting, knowledge of chip architectureHardware description languages (HDL), digital logic design, simulation
Industry UsageSemiconductor companies, chip manufacturersSemiconductor, electronics, and tech companies

The Silicon Validation Engineer focuses on testing and verifying silicon chips after fabrication, ensuring they meet specifications. In contrast, the Digital Design Engineer is involved in designing digital circuits and systems before fabrication. Both roles require knowledge of hardware and digital logic, but their stages in the product lifecycle differ significantly.
